Localization vs. Translation

Localization goes beyond mere translation; it adapts content to reflect local culture, idioms, and preferences. When crafting Spanish digital content, consider how language varies across regions. For instance, a phrase that resonates in Spain may not have the same impact in Latin America. This is where skilled voice talent comes into play. Utilizing voiceover artists who understand regional nuances ensures that your message feels authentic and relatable. They can infuse localized expressions into their delivery, creating a connection with listeners that purely translated scripts often lack.

SEO Considerations for Spanish Content

Search engine optimization (SEO) plays a vital role in making your Spanish content discoverable. Start by researching keywords relevant to your audience’s search habits in their native language. Use these keywords strategically throughout your content to improve visibility on search engines like Google or Bing.

Integrate long-tail keywords specific to the context of your material—these phrases are often less competitive yet highly relevant to users’ searches. Don’t forget about metadata; optimize titles, descriptions, and alt text with appropriate terms while ensuring they maintain natural readability.

Software and Platforms

Using the right software can streamline your Spanish content creation process. Here are some essential tools:

  • Editing Software: Programs like Adobe Premiere Pro or Final Cut Pro offer robust editing capabilities for video content. These tools include features for adding voiceovers, ensuring seamless integration of audio with visuals.
  • Audio Editing Tools: Audacity or GarageBand serve as excellent options for recording and editing voiceover tracks. They allow you to refine audio quality, adjust levels, and incorporate sound effects.
  • Translation Services: Tools such as SDL Trados or Memsource facilitate localization by helping you adapt your scripts effectively while maintaining cultural nuances.
  • Content Management Systems (CMS): Platforms like WordPress or HubSpot simplify managing multilingual websites, allowing you to publish Spanish-language content alongside other languages easily.

Leveraging these software options boosts efficiency in producing high-quality Spanish digital content while making sure it resonates with your audience.
